Divide 3x^2 + 4x − 4 by x + 2.
A. x − 2
B. x + 6
C. 3x − 2
D. 3x + 6

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 01-01-2020

Answer:

It is C

Step-by-step explanation:

(3x-2)(x+2)

3x(x)+3x(2)-2(x)-2(2)

3x^2+6x-2x-4

3x^2+4x-4 <----------
